Techno rebels

Techno rebels

1999 • 163 pages
Techno Rebels

Techno Rebels

Type: Physical Book

Language: English

Pages: 176

Release Date: 2010-04-15

ISBN 10: 0814337120

ISBN 13: 9780814337127

Country: United States of America